What are the most common types of anti-static measures for arcade electronics?

Arcade electronics, like all sensitive electronic equipment, are vulnerable to damage from electrostatic discharge (ESD). To protect these gaming machines, several anti-static measures are commonly employed:

1. Anti-Static Flooring and Mats: Special conductive or dissipative flooring and mats reduce static buildup around arcade machines.

2. ESD Wristbands and Clothing: Technicians and operators wear anti-static wristbands and clothing to prevent static transfer during maintenance.

3. Humidity Control: Maintaining optimal humidity levels (40-60%) minimizes static electricity generation in arcade environments.

4. Grounding Straps and Cables: Proper grounding of arcade cabinets and components ensures static charges are safely discharged.

5. Static-Shielding Bags: Sensitive parts are stored and transported in anti-static bags to prevent ESD damage.

Implementing these measures helps extend the lifespan of arcade electronics and ensures smooth gameplay for users.
